Features:

1. Designed for high-demand 4G infrastructure

Engineered to deliver 80W dual-channel output with exceptional linearity and thermal efficiency, supporting continuous operation in base station and repeater applications.

2. Dual-directional gain control with ALC integration

Features independent uplink and downlink gain paths, with downlink ALC range ≥10dB and gain adjustment ≥25dB for precise signal conditioning under varying input conditions.

3. Real-time system health monitoring and logging

Built-in telemetry for forward power, temperature, VSWR, and fault status, accessible via RS485 (9600 baud) for integration into remote supervision platforms.

4. Fail-safe over-power and over-temperature protection

Automatically triggers alarms and disables the amplifier when output exceeds +2dB above max rating or temperature reaches +85°C, with automatic recovery at +65°C.

5. High-isolation Tx-Rx path design

Achieves ≥55dB isolation between transmitter and receiver paths, minimizing leakage and improving system sensitivity in full-duplex FDD operation.

6. Low-noise uplink performance

Uplink noise figure ≤3dB ensures weak signal integrity, ideal for cell-edge scenarios and environments with high interference or long cable runs.

7. Wide operating temperature range for outdoor deployment

Fully functional from -40°C to +55°C, with derating and thermal management designed for solar-powered or remote telecom shelters.

8. Modular RS485 command set for integration flexibility

Supports gain setting, status query, and alarm retrieval through a simple software protocol, enabling custom control logic without additional hardware layers.

9. Compact mechanical layout with dual-wire 28V power input

Mechanical dimensions optimized for 19" chassis or pole-mount enclosures, with dual-wire 28V DC input reducing wiring complexity in field deployments.

10. Seamless frequency band customization

Available in B1 (2.1G), B3 (1.8G), B7 (2.6G), and B8 (900M) variants, allowing operators to standardize on a single hardware platform across multiple 4G bands.

Uplink (UL) & Downlink (UL) Specifications:

Frequency Range:

1.   B1:
a. UL:1920-1980MHz
b.   DL:2110-2170MHz
2.   B3
a. UL:1710-1785MHz
b. DL:1805-1880MHz

3.   B7
a. UL:2500-2570MHz
b. DL:2620-2690MHz
4.   B8
a. UL:880-915MHz
b. DL:925-960MHz

Max Gain:

1.   UL:25±2dB

2.   DL:53±2dB

Maximum Output Power:

1.   UL:Uncontrolled

2.   DL:49±1dBm

Maximum Input Level:

1.   UL:NONE

2.   DL:+10dBm

Gain Adjustment Range:

1.   UL:NONE

2.   DL:≥25dB

ALC Range:

1.   UL:NONE

2.   DL:≥10dB

Gain Flatness:

1.   UL:NONE

2.   DL

a.  ATT10dB: ≤±1dB

b.  ATT20dB: ≤±1dB

c.  ATT25dB: ≤±1.5dB

In-Band Ripple:

≤2.5dB

Noise Figure:

1.   UL:≤3dB

2.   DL:NONE

Tx-Rx Isolation:

≥55dBc

EVM:

≤8% (Peak-to-Average Power Ratio 10.0dB)

VSWR:

  1. UL:≤1.4 (Test condition: power on for testing after turning off the uplink power amplifier.)

2.   UL:≤1.4 (Test condition: power on for testing after turning off the downlink power amplifier.)

Operating Voltage:

 28V DC, dual-wire power supply configuration

Operating Current:

With APD: ≤9A

Operating Current:

With APD: ≤9A

Baud Rate:

9600

Working Temperature:

-40~+55℃

Over-Temperature Protection:

Alarm and shutdown at +85℃, resume operation at 65℃

Monitoring Functions:

1.   For the wiring diagram of the monitoring port, refer to the outline dimension drawing; RS485 interface communication

a.  Settings: switch, gain;

b.  Query: module status (including power amplifier status, over-power alarm, over-temperature alarm), power amplifier temperature, power amplifier ATT value, detected forward power;

c.   Over-power alarm: alarm when the power exceeds the maximum output power by +2dB;

d.  Over-temperature alarm: recommended threshold is +85℃; alarm is triggered when the detected temperature exceeds +85℃, and the

power amplifier is turned off simultaneously, then turned on at +65℃;

e.   Power amplifier temperature detection: the detection range shall

include but not be limited to -25℃~+85℃, with a detection accuracy of ±3℃;

f.   Forward power detection: the detection range shall be greater than 20dB, with a detection accuracy of less than ±1dB;
